All went well until… I thought I was being clever by using masking fluid for the little stars to color them after I had done the watercolor background. However, I forgot that 1) this particular sketchbook is not very watercolor friendly as the paper dissolves rather quickly and 2) I was too impatient and started rubbing the dried masking fluid away when the paper underneath was still wet from the watercolor.
